Cosmological Views

The gods walked the earth one time, they shaped the world, and created beautiful waterfalls and rivers which glowed with light. At least, until one of them tried to capture the light-water to form a creation of their own, and hid as much as he could deep in the earth. Eventually the people of the world cried out for they had no light and could not live in the dark. Thus the creators awoke the Dwarves to to Sing to the stone and open the world to the capture light water. Unfortunately then the Needless Crafter gave humanity a glass vase which would hold all the colors of the light-water, all they had to was dip it in the light-water.   The humans did so, but unbeknownst to the Needless Crafter, they drank the water when they were thirsty, thus turning the blood in their veins in vibrant colors and light, granting them unique strengths. They sailed across the prismatic sea and drained it of its light until they reached a new lands where they reigned like gods themselves.   But then the Dwarves sang a great song to the creator gods, lamenting that the light they had was beginning to fade as they were forced to drink it, and the world was beginning to dim. Thus with a great united song, the Dwarves called upon the creators. The creators answered their plight by taking the remaining water and turning it into a gemstone which contained a spot for all the glittering light of the world, and they put it in the sky, naming it The Songstone.   Here in the sky the Songstone absorbed the light of the world across it and reflected it back to where light was imbalanced.
